[PS:
Following the manual, I tried to start CinGG(ffmpeg7) with:
CIN_HW_DEV=vaapi ./cin
Now loading works without errors and playback works with a certain
percentage of GPU
acceleration (8-20%). If you try scrolling, however, there are
continuous freezes and
artifacts. But there are no messages and errors in the terminal.
